Swedish
Etymology
From Old Norse vaxa, from Proto-Germanic *wahsijaną, from Proto-Indo-European *h₂weg-, cognate with wax (of the moon).

Verb
växa (present växer, preterite växte, supine vuxit or växt, imperative väx)
- grow; increase in size
- kyrkan och kungens makt växte i betydelse
- the church and the power of the king grew in significance
- grow; sprout
- 1891, Selma Lögerlöf, “23, Patron Julius [23, Squire Julius]”, in Gösta Berlings Saga [Gösta Berling's Saga] (fiction), Frithiof Hellbergs förlag, →ISBN, OCLC 606362161, page 276:
- Längs vägen vuxo prästkragar och sötblomster och gökärter.
- Along the way grew daisies and camomiles and bitter vetches.

Usage notes
The strong singular past tense (originally vox) is never seen, but there is an archaic plural past tense vuxo and a subjunctive vuxe. There is also the past participle vuxen, which has taken on a sense of grown-up or adult.
